How to Make Honeydew Bubble Tea (Traditional & Healthy Version)

Honeydew Bubble Tea has become a beloved beverage across Malaysia, blending locally grown honeydew melon with creamy, refreshing elements and chewy tapioca pearls. While bubble tea originated globally, Malaysia’s multicultural food scene has embraced it, infusing unique flavors with ingredients like pandan and santan (coconut milk). In this recipe, we highlight the fruity sweetness of honeydew, complemented by the aromatic depth of pandan leaves and a touch of santan, all while keeping it light and healthy. The result is a vibrant, cooling drink perfect for Malaysia’s tropical climate. This Honeydew Bubble Tea is a delightful fusion inspired by Malaysia’s love for fresh fruit drinks and textural contrasts. It’s commonly enjoyed by young Malaysians in cafes and kopitiams, especially as a midday treat or alongside light meals. Using fresh honeydew, plant-based milk, and homemade tapioca pearls, this recipe is vegetarian and can easily be adapted for vegan diets. The inclusion of pandan and santan highlights Malaysia’s rich culinary heritage, making it not just a drink, but a celebration of local flavors and multicultural influences.

Cook tapioca pearls according to package instructions or boil homemade pearls for 15 minutes until they become chewy. Rinse and soak in cold water to prevent sticking.

Blend diced honeydew melon with santan, pandan leaves (knot for easy removal), and low-fat milk until smooth and fragrant.

Add stevia or gula melaka to the honeydew mixture. Blend again until well mixed. Adjust sweetness to taste.

Strain the honeydew mixture to remove pulp, if preferred, for a smoother texture.

Fill serving glasses with cooked tapioca pearls. Add ice cubes over the pearls.

Pour the honeydew blend over the ice and pearls. Add a splash of vanilla extract and lemongrass if desired.

Stir gently and serve immediately with wide bubble tea straws.

This Honeydew Bubble Tea is a healthier alternative to typical bubble teas, using fresh fruit, santan, and minimal sugar. By incorporating plant-based milk and stevia or gula melaka, it reduces saturated fat and refined sugar intake. The recipe is high in hydration, vitamins, and minerals, making it suitable for calorie tracking and wellness goals. Its low calorie density makes it ideal for weight management and those seeking nutritious refreshment.

Bubble tea culture has taken root in Malaysia, particularly in urban areas like Kuala Lumpur and Penang. Honeydew Bubble Tea, with its refreshing tropical flavor, is popular among youth and families during hot afternoons. Incorporating local ingredients like santan and pandan connects this global beverage to Malaysian tastes. Often enjoyed during casual gatherings, it reflects the nation’s multicultural approach to food, blending Chinese tea culture with Malay and local flavors.
